Dr. Mingfeng Ge is a pioneering researcher at the intersection of microfluidics, artificial intelligence, and single-cell biology. His work centers on developing intelligent, automated platforms for single-cell analysis—a field critical for unraveling cellular heterogeneity in complex biological systems. Dr. Ge’s most notable contribution is the creation of an active-matrix digital microfluidics system enhanced by large language models (LLMs) and object detection algorithms. This breakthrough addresses longstanding limitations in single-cell sample manipulation, including high costs, low throughput, and excessive human intervention. His 2025 paper on this topic has already garnered 6 citations, signaling its rapid impact. By integrating AI-driven decision-making with precise microfluidic control, Dr. Ge’s research paves the way for high-throughput, cost-effective, and fully automated single-cell analysis. His work holds transformative potential for applications in drug discovery, disease diagnostics, and personalized medicine.
